About Vets First Choice

Vets First Choice is a healthcare technology company that provides veterinary practices with a suite of online tools to manage their businesses. The company was founded in 2010 by Benjamin Shaw and David Shaw. Vets First Choice's platform allows veterinarians to manage their inventory, prescriptions, and client communications online. The company also offers a range of analytics and reporting tools to help practices optimize their operations. Vets First Choice's mission is to improve the quality of care for animals by providing veterinarians with the tools they need to succeed.
